Package org.apache.flink.fnexecution.v1
Interface FlinkFnApi.Schema.FieldTypeOrBuilder
-
- All Superinterfaces:
com.google.protobuf.MessageLiteOrBuilder
,com.google.protobuf.MessageOrBuilder
- All Known Implementing Classes:
FlinkFnApi.Schema.FieldType
,FlinkFnApi.Schema.FieldType.Builder
- Enclosing class:
- FlinkFnApi.Schema
public static interface FlinkFnApi.Schema.FieldTypeOrBuilder extends com.google.protobuf.MessageOrBuilder
-
-
Method Summary
All Methods Instance Methods Abstract Methods Modifier and Type Method Description FlinkFnApi.Schema.BinaryInfo
getBinaryInfo()
.org.apache.flink.fn_execution.v1.Schema.BinaryInfo binary_info = 11;
FlinkFnApi.Schema.BinaryInfoOrBuilder
getBinaryIn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.BinaryInfo binary_info = 11;
FlinkFnApi.Schema.CharInfo
getCharInfo()
.org.apache.flink.fn_execution.v1.Schema.CharInfo char_info = 13;
FlinkFnApi.Schema.CharInfoOrBuilder
getCharIn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.CharInfo char_info = 13;
FlinkFnApi.Schema.FieldType
getCollectionElementType()
.org.apache.flink.fn_execution.v1.Schema.FieldType collection_element_type = 3;
FlinkFnApi.Schema.FieldTypeOrBuilder
getCollectionElementTypeO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.FieldType collection_element_type = 3;
FlinkFnApi.Schema.DecimalInfo
getDecimalInfo()
.org.apache.flink.fn_execution.v1.Schema.DecimalInfo decimal_info = 6;
FlinkFnApi.Schema.DecimalInfoOrBuilder
getDecimalIn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.DecimalInfo decimal_info = 6;
FlinkFnApi.Schema.LocalZonedTimestampInfo
getLocalZonedT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.LocalZonedTimestampInfo local_zoned_timestamp_info = 9;
FlinkFnApi.Schema.LocalZonedTimestampInfoOrBuilder
getLocalZonedTimestampIn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.LocalZonedTimestampInfo local_zoned_timestamp_info = 9;
FlinkFnApi.Schema.MapInfo
getMapInfo()
.org.apache.flink.fn_execution.v1.Schema.MapInfo map_info = 4;
FlinkFnApi.Schema.MapInfoOrBuilder
getMapIn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.MapInfo map_info = 4;
boolean
getNullable()
bool nullable = 2;
FlinkFnApi.Schema
getRowSchema()
.org.apache.flink.fn_execution.v1.Schema row_schema = 5;
FlinkFnApi.SchemaOrBuilder
getRowSchemaOrBuilder()
.org.apache.flink.fn_execution.v1.Schema row_schema = 5;
FlinkFnApi.Schema.TimeInfo
getTimeInfo()
.org.apache.flink.fn_execution.v1.Schema.TimeInfo time_info = 7;
FlinkFnApi.Schema.TimeInfoOrBuilder
getTimeIn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.TimeInfo time_info = 7;
FlinkFnApi.Schema.TimestampInfo
getT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.TimestampInfo timestamp_info = 8;
FlinkFnApi.Schema.TimestampInfoOrBuilder
getTimestampIn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.TimestampInfo timestamp_info = 8;
FlinkFnApi.Schema.FieldType.TypeInfoCase
getTypeInfoCase()
FlinkFnApi.Schema.TypeName
getTypeName()
.org.apache.flink.fn_execution.v1.Schema.TypeName type_name = 1;
int
getTypeNameValue()
.org.apache.flink.fn_execution.v1.Schema.TypeName type_name = 1;
FlinkFnApi.Schema.VarBinaryInfo
getVarBinaryInfo()
.org.apache.flink.fn_execution.v1.Schema.VarBinaryInfo var_binary_info = 12;
FlinkFnApi.Schema.VarBinaryInfoOrBuilder
getVarBinaryIn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.VarBinaryInfo var_binary_info = 12;
FlinkFnApi.Schema.VarCharInfo
getVarCharInfo()
.org.apache.flink.fn_execution.v1.Schema.VarCharInfo var_char_info = 14;
FlinkFnApi.Schema.VarCharInfoOrBuilder
getVarCharIn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.VarCharInfo var_char_info = 14;
FlinkFnApi.Schema.ZonedTimestampInfo
getZonedT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.ZonedTimestampInfo zoned_timestamp_info = 10;
FlinkFnApi.Schema.ZonedTimestampInfoOrBuilder
getZonedTimestampIn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.ZonedTimestampInfo zoned_timestamp_info = 10;
boolean
hasBinaryInfo()
.org.apache.flink.fn_execution.v1.Schema.BinaryInfo binary_info = 11;
boolean
hasCharInfo()
.org.apache.flink.fn_execution.v1.Schema.CharInfo char_info = 13;
boolean
hasCollectionElementType()
.org.apache.flink.fn_execution.v1.Schema.FieldType collection_element_type = 3;
boolean
hasDecimalInfo()
.org.apache.flink.fn_execution.v1.Schema.DecimalInfo decimal_info = 6;
boolean
hasLocalZonedT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.LocalZonedTimestampInfo local_zoned_timestamp_info = 9;
boolean
hasMapInfo()
.org.apache.flink.fn_execution.v1.Schema.MapInfo map_info = 4;
boolean
hasRowSchema()
.org.apache.flink.fn_execution.v1.Schema row_schema = 5;
boolean
hasTimeInfo()
.org.apache.flink.fn_execution.v1.Schema.TimeInfo time_info = 7;
boolean
hasT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.TimestampInfo timestamp_info = 8;
boolean
hasVarBinaryInfo()
.org.apache.flink.fn_execution.v1.Schema.VarBinaryInfo var_binary_info = 12;
boolean
hasVarCharInfo()
.org.apache.flink.fn_execution.v1.Schema.VarCharInfo var_char_info = 14;
boolean
hasZonedT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.ZonedTimestampInfo zoned_timestamp_info = 10;
-
Methods inherited from interface com.google.protobuf.MessageOrBuilder
findInitializationErrors, getAllFields, getDefaultInstanceForType, getDescriptorForType, getField, getInitializationErrorString, getOneofFieldDescriptor, getRepeatedField, getRepeatedFieldCount, getUnknownFields, hasField, hasOneof
-
-
-
-
Method Detail
-
getTypeNameValue
int getTypeNameValue()
.org.apache.flink.fn_execution.v1.Schema.TypeName type_name = 1;
- Returns:
- The enum numeric value on the wire for typeName.
-
getTypeName
FlinkFnApi.Schema.TypeName getTypeName()
.org.apache.flink.fn_execution.v1.Schema.TypeName type_name = 1;
- Returns:
- The typeName.
-
getNullable
boolean getNullable()
bool nullable = 2;
- Returns:
- The nullable.
-
hasCollectionElementType
boolean hasCollectionElementType()
.org.apache.flink.fn_execution.v1.Schema.FieldType collection_element_type = 3;
- Returns:
- Whether the collectionElementType field is set.
-
getCollectionElementType
FlinkFnApi.Schema.FieldType getCollectionElementType()
.org.apache.flink.fn_execution.v1.Schema.FieldType collection_element_type = 3;
- Returns:
- The collectionElementType.
-
getCollectionElementTypeOrBuilder
FlinkFnApi.Schema.FieldTypeOrBuilder getCollectionElementTypeO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.FieldType collection_element_type = 3;
-
hasMapInfo
boolean hasMapInfo()
.org.apache.flink.fn_execution.v1.Schema.MapInfo map_info = 4;
- Returns:
- Whether the mapInfo field is set.
-
getMapInfo
FlinkFnApi.Schema.MapInfo getMapInfo()
.org.apache.flink.fn_execution.v1.Schema.MapInfo map_info = 4;
- Returns:
- The mapInfo.
-
getMapInfoOrBuilder
FlinkFnApi.Schema.MapInfoOrBuilder getMapIn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.MapInfo map_info = 4;
-
hasRowSchema
boolean hasRowSchema()
.org.apache.flink.fn_execution.v1.Schema row_schema = 5;
- Returns:
- Whether the rowSchema field is set.
-
getRowSchema
FlinkFnApi.Schema getRowSchema()
.org.apache.flink.fn_execution.v1.Schema row_schema = 5;
- Returns:
- The rowSchema.
-
getRowSchemaOrBuilder
FlinkFnApi.SchemaOrBuilder getRowSchemaOrBuilder()
.org.apache.flink.fn_execution.v1.Schema row_schema = 5;
-
hasDecimalInfo
boolean hasDecimalInfo()
.org.apache.flink.fn_execution.v1.Schema.DecimalInfo decimal_info = 6;
- Returns:
- Whether the decimalInfo field is set.
-
getDecimalInfo
FlinkFnApi.Schema.DecimalInfo getDecimalInfo()
.org.apache.flink.fn_execution.v1.Schema.DecimalInfo decimal_info = 6;
- Returns:
- The decimalInfo.
-
getDecimalInfoOrBuilder
FlinkFnApi.Schema.DecimalInfoOrBuilder getDecimalIn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.DecimalInfo decimal_info = 6;
-
hasTimeInfo
boolean hasTimeInfo()
.org.apache.flink.fn_execution.v1.Schema.TimeInfo time_info = 7;
- Returns:
- Whether the timeInfo field is set.
-
getTimeInfo
FlinkFnApi.Schema.TimeInfo getTimeInfo()
.org.apache.flink.fn_execution.v1.Schema.TimeInfo time_info = 7;
- Returns:
- The timeInfo.
-
getTimeInfoOrBuilder
FlinkFnApi.Schema.TimeInfoOrBuilder getTimeIn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.TimeInfo time_info = 7;
-
hasTimestampInfo
boolean hasT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.TimestampInfo timestamp_info = 8;
- Returns:
- Whether the timestampInfo field is set.
-
getTimestampInfo
FlinkFnApi.Schema.TimestampInfo getT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.TimestampInfo timestamp_info = 8;
- Returns:
- The timestampInfo.
-
getTimestampInfoOrBuilder
FlinkFnApi.Schema.TimestampInfoOrBuilder getTimestampIn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.TimestampInfo timestamp_info = 8;
-
hasLocalZonedTimestampInfo
boolean hasLocalZonedT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.LocalZonedTimestampInfo local_zoned_timestamp_info = 9;
- Returns:
- Whether the localZonedTimestampInfo field is set.
-
getLocalZonedTimestampInfo
FlinkFnApi.Schema.LocalZonedTimestampInfo getLocalZonedT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.LocalZonedTimestampInfo local_zoned_timestamp_info = 9;
- Returns:
- The localZonedTimestampInfo.
-
getLocalZonedTimestampInfoOrBuilder
FlinkFnApi.Schema.LocalZonedTimestampInfoOrBuilder getLocalZonedTimestampIn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.LocalZonedTimestampInfo local_zoned_timestamp_info = 9;
-
hasZonedTimestampInfo
boolean hasZonedT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.ZonedTimestampInfo zoned_timestamp_info = 10;
- Returns:
- Whether the zonedTimestampInfo field is set.
-
getZonedTimestampInfo
FlinkFnApi.Schema.ZonedTimestampInfo getZonedTimestampInfo()
.org.apache.flink.fn_execution.v1.Schema.ZonedTimestampInfo zoned_timestamp_info = 10;
- Returns:
- The zonedTimestampInfo.
-
getZonedTimestampInfoOrBuilder
FlinkFnApi.Schema.ZonedTimestampInfoOrBuilder getZonedTimestampIn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.ZonedTimestampInfo zoned_timestamp_info = 10;
-
hasBinaryInfo
boolean hasBinaryInfo()
.org.apache.flink.fn_execution.v1.Schema.BinaryInfo binary_info = 11;
- Returns:
- Whether the binaryInfo field is set.
-
getBinaryInfo
FlinkFnApi.Schema.BinaryInfo getBinaryInfo()
.org.apache.flink.fn_execution.v1.Schema.BinaryInfo binary_info = 11;
- Returns:
- The binaryInfo.
-
getBinaryInfoOrBuilder
FlinkFnApi.Schema.BinaryInfoOrBuilder getBinaryIn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.BinaryInfo binary_info = 11;
-
hasVarBinaryInfo
boolean hasVarBinaryInfo()
.org.apache.flink.fn_execution.v1.Schema.VarBinaryInfo var_binary_info = 12;
- Returns:
- Whether the varBinaryInfo field is set.
-
getVarBinaryInfo
FlinkFnApi.Schema.VarBinaryInfo getVarBinaryInfo()
.org.apache.flink.fn_execution.v1.Schema.VarBinaryInfo var_binary_info = 12;
- Returns:
- The varBinaryInfo.
-
getVarBinaryInfoOrBuilder
FlinkFnApi.Schema.VarBinaryInfoOrBuilder getVarBinaryIn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.VarBinaryInfo var_binary_info = 12;
-
hasCharInfo
boolean hasCharInfo()
.org.apache.flink.fn_execution.v1.Schema.CharInfo char_info = 13;
- Returns:
- Whether the charInfo field is set.
-
getCharInfo
FlinkFnApi.Schema.CharInfo getCharInfo()
.org.apache.flink.fn_execution.v1.Schema.CharInfo char_info = 13;
- Returns:
- The charInfo.
-
getCharInfoOrBuilder
FlinkFnApi.Schema.CharInfoOrBuilder getCharIn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.CharInfo char_info = 13;
-
hasVarCharInfo
boolean hasVarCharInfo()
.org.apache.flink.fn_execution.v1.Schema.VarCharInfo var_char_info = 14;
- Returns:
- Whether the varCharInfo field is set.
-
getVarCharInfo
FlinkFnApi.Schema.VarCharInfo getVarCharInfo()
.org.apache.flink.fn_execution.v1.Schema.VarCharInfo var_char_info = 14;
- Returns:
- The varCharInfo.
-
getVarCharInfoOrBuilder
FlinkFnApi.Schema.VarCharInfoOrBuilder getVarCharInfoOrBuilder()
.org.apache.flink.fn_execution.v1.Schema.VarCharInfo var_char_info = 14;
-
getTypeInfoCase
FlinkFnApi.Schema.FieldType.TypeInfoCase getTypeInfoCase()
-
-